Carina spent a total of $5.27 buying a pineapple for $3.40 and several pounds of tomatoes that were on sale for $0.85 per pound.

To determine the number of pounds of tomatoes that she bought, x, Carina wrote and solved the equation as shown below.

Okay so I'm going to set up a equation:

5.27= 3.40+ 0.85x, we have our total our price of one pineapple and our variable

next I isolate the variable:

5.27-3.40=0.85x

next:

1.87=0.85x

x= 2.2

she bought 2.2 pounds of tomatoes
